any idea where Texas island is?? supossed to be the south end of the lake and TB's = of snake island! 

where to launch & how to get there?

yes, there is a launch on Hwy 255 on the very south end. You can go to Burkeville on Hwy 87, when you get to the 4way stop take a right on Hwy 63, go over the hill and take a left on FM 692, 14 miles to Hwy 255, take a left and go about 3/4 mile, public boat ramp sign on the right.
692 is a very curvy road. If you want , stay on 87 for 9 more miles and take a right on 255, the 14 miles to the ramp. 
When you launch at the ramp and go out of that cove, your on Toledo Bay (big water)  Look to your left (north) there is a boat lane about 1/2 mile out that goes north. You can see Texas island as soon as you leave the ramp.  Its a big island. There is a beach on the north end, but lots of boats are in a small cove on the mainland to the left of the boat lane where it goes past the Island. Nice place.  If you go around the corner following the boat lane, there are some big coves to the left that have sand bars also.

Zoom in on google earth, and you can see the island the river is just to the east of it

Not sure about the Game wardens, I emailed Sabine River authority about headers. They said there were no rules about noise or speed on Toledo. Used to be a lot of jets and such, not too many anymore. The wardens will check you for safety equipment though.

Another good place to launch is Paradise Point. If you stay on 87 through Burkeville, pass 255 then go another 7 miles there about. Fm 3315 Takes a right. Go about 7 miles and  you will see the Big sign on the right. Paradise Point Park  (paradisepointpark.com) .
If you put in there, Texas Island is to the South East, about 2-3 miles, you can see it.
